There's a place in your GIO account settings to disable or enable
having emails you send to the group coming back to you. If you don't
want that, uncheck that box. If you want that, then check that box.

It's at the very bottom of the Display Preferences section in your GIO
account and it could very well be the reason why she's not seeing her
own emails from one account and seeing them from the other.

If you have more than one account, I don't know which account that
link takes you to. But if you log in manually to GIO and go to your
account settings, then display properties, check that setting. If
that's set so you get copies of all your messages, then the only thing
left is one of your MSN accounts has something turned on or off that
prevents getting your own emails. One account might have it set one
way and the other the opposite way.

Re: Photos and attachments

 

Tommy,

I'm going to take the liberty of inserting and attaching an image of a
1917 newspaper page listing various railroad passenger train services
at San Antonio Texas. ... and though they were viewable in the email,
Both came through cleanly (legibly) in my email as well.

Thunderbird showed the attached copy inline after the message body (per one of my option settings), and the Gmail web interface showed the attachment as a thumbnail (click to view and download).

The inline image was formatted in the message body as a normal-looking HTML <img> tag:

<img src=cid:[email protected]" />

"cid" is the traditional attachment protocol for inline images, so nothing funky there.

... they were not viewable when the message was posted.
This looks like a bug to me.

The inline image ought to show inline, and the attachment thumbnail ought to be clickable to view/download. For the attachment I get the same XML error code you copied.

I don't know exactly what the problem is. It doesn't seem to be a problem with how the web message poster is formatting the message, given that at least two different email interfaces display it correctly. So I'm guessing it is a problem in the Messages display when one views the message.

I then converted the images to a jpeg -- by making two screen caps and
pasting them together -- but they still don't come through.
Given that inline and attached images normally work for me and others, my first thought was that the image file format is something that Groups.io image viewing couldn't handle. But that second test should have cured that, I would think.

You're welcome to experiment with different image formats in shalstest (I recently approved your membership) to see if you can identify what does and does not work - I'm sure that info will help Mark enormously in tracking down the problem. But ultimately this seems to me like it needs to be reported in beta as a #bug.

Shal

Tommy -
No explanations, but here's a possible solution. I have some similar groups, and occasionally see problems with things captured by posters?pasting an image to M$ Word. I believe the problems come from filtering the image?through Word itself, and I suspect?it gets compounded when people try to open it without Word.
?
One thing I have tried to do is get people to run the image through Irfanview instead of a word processing program. (?- It's free.) After right clicking the image and saving it, open Irfanview and use Edit > Paste to put it into Irfanview. ?Then use File > Save as to save it as an image file. My personal preference is to?save as?JPG files because they're pretty universally accepted. (Because of the inherent compression of JPG, the file is also not quite as good as the original which helps?mitigate some of the copyright issues.)
?
Treating it as an image file in the first place seems to avoid a lot of the conversion snafus that using a word processor might trigger. It also avoids the setup stuff they might add to the file.
?

Re: I am the group owner but do not see messages I post

 

On Sun, Aug 2, 2020 at 09:13 AM, Monica Utsey wrote:
I sent a test message and the message shows in groups.io, but it is not delivered to my email.?

Monica -- I suspect the messages are being filtered as spam. Are you using webmail, or an email client? If the latter, which client is it (Outlook, W10 Mail, ???)? Is the client using a spam filtering add-on, or are you letting your provider do that?

It's not unusual for an email provider to filter out incoming messages that seem to have originated "from yourself."?They assume that if you really sent it, it should already be in your Sent folder, and you don't need another copy. This filtering can be based either on the From: line or the . Mail client add-ons and other protection services (e.g. Norton 360) may apply similar logic.

If you haven't already done so, go online with MSN and check your spam/junk folder. If the missing messages are landing there, you can often set up a mail filter to redirect them to your inbox...perhaps based on your group's Subject Tag. Or if you can provide us with more details on what protection software is loaded on your computer, there may be a way to simply turn off this kind of aggressive spam filtering.
